Davis: “That’s why I didn’t celebrate LeBron’s record”

by

A few 24 hours ago, Mr LeBron James is the leading scorer in (Regular Season) history NBA.

When the “king” put the basket that sent him to the top of the specific list against the Thunderas is reasonable, there was a pandemonium on the field, both in the stands and on the bench of the Lakers. However, there was also one, the Anthony Daviswho reacted with… cold indifference, just sitting on the bench as if nothing had happened.

Many immediately drew from this specific incident the conclusion that the relationships between him LeBron and of “AD” have come to a rupture. However, the American forward was quick to explain why he did not celebrate, stressing that it had nothing to do with Jamesbut with the fact that the Lakers were behind in the score and it looked like they were going to lose the game.

“You know my relationship with LeBron… It didn’t mean anything. It was all about the game. We lost to the Oklahoma City Thunder, a game we needed, I was pissed off. We were just losing. Fair and simple. Nothing to do with LeBron, he knows that. Outsiders may have a different opinion. I was just mad that we were losing the game.”Davis specifically explained.
